hai, As your father diabetic control status is not fair enough. seems to be poor. he certainly need proper attention and treatment. proper drugs,diet control,exercise will keep your father diabetes under control.
constant high level of blood sugar will lead to systemic abnormality like damage to the target organs like heart,brain,kidney etc. HBA1C test will help in assessing average blood sugar level for the past months. with that report and your father's complaints / associated symptoms kindly consult a diabetologist for proper treatment and management.
